How did the Zimmerman telegram change American's opinion of world war 1?​

Respuesta :

twin5958
twin5958 twin5958
  • 26-02-2021

Explanation:

The telegram was considered perhaps Britain's greatest intelligence coup of World War I and, coupled with American outrage over Germany's resumption of unrestricted submarine warfare, was the tipping point persuading the U.S. to join the war.
